Northside Hospital Inc. is seeking a skilled Cardiac Monitor Technician to join our team. As a Cardiac Monitor Technician, you will play a critical role in the ongoing surveillance of patient cardiac monitors/remote telemetry and provide immediate notification of any changes in cardiac rhythms to RNs and/or clinicians.
Responsibilities- Monitor patient cardiac rhythms and provide real-time notification of any changes or abnormalities.
- Collaborate with RNs and/or clinicians to ensure accurate and timely reporting of cardiac rhythm changes.
- Participate in the development and implementation of cardiac rhythm analysis protocols.
- Provide education and training to staff on cardiac rhythm analysis and interpretation.
- Contribute to the maintenance of accurate and up-to-date patient records.
- High school diploma or equivalent required.
- American Heart Association Basic Life Support certification required.
- One (1) or more years of experience working as a Monitor Technician preferred.
- Successful completion of a basic arrhythmia course or equivalent coursework with a passing score required.
- CRAT (Certified Rhythm Analysis Technician) Certification through CCI preferred.
- 7a-7p work hours.
- Weekend requirements: Yes.
- On-call requirements: No.
